US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"increased diversity"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ing the growth or enhancement of variety within a group, organization, or community. Example: "The company's commitment to increased diversity has led to a more innovative and inclusive workplace."

Linguistic Context

The phrase "increased diversity" functions as a noun phrase, where "increased" acts as an adjective modifying the noun "diversity". It describes the state of having a greater variety of elements within a group or system. Ludwig AI confirms its usability.

FAQs

How can I use "increased diversity" in a sentence?

Use "increased diversity" to describe a situation where there is a greater variety of people, ideas, or things. For instance, "The company aims for "increased diversity" in its hiring practices".

What are some alternatives to "increased diversity"?

Consider using alternatives such as "greater diversity", "enhanced diversity", or "growing diversity" depending on the specific nuance you wish to convey.

Is it correct to say "increase diversity" or "increased diversity"?

"Increase diversity" is a verb phrase suggesting an action to make something more diverse. "Increased diversity" is a noun phrase referring to the state of being more diverse.

What's the difference between "diversity" and ""increased diversity""?

"Diversity" refers to the general concept of variety. "Increased diversity" specifically indicates that there has been a growth or expansion in that variety.
